We're looking for a Senior Data Analyst - Regulatory Reporting (IC2) to join the team in London. This is a high-impact role where your work directly enables Wise to operate and grow in regulated markets worldwide. You'll own the end-to-end lifecycle of regulatory reporting datasets — from understanding regulations and mapping them to internal data, through building and automating pipelines, to delivering clear visualisations and insights to stakeholders. You'll work at the intersection of finance, compliance, and data engineering, collaborating with teams across the business to ensure our reporting keeps pace with regulatory demands, Wise's growth and expansion, and its evolving data infrastructure.

This is a role for someone who combines strong technical skills, clear communication, and a drive to deeply understand the regulatory landscape and Wise's products. You'll translate that understanding into data — building things that are robust, scalable, efficient, and trusted.

Wise's Regulatory Reporting Analytics team builds and maintains the data infrastructure that underpins our regulatory obligations across multiple jurisdictions. We ensure that reporting datasets are accurate, automated, and scalable — enabling Wise to obtain and retain operating licenses while meeting audit and partnership requirements.

This team plays a critical role in:
  • Powering regulatory compliance across Wise's legal entities.
  • Supporting controlled growth and expansion by onboarding new entities, features, and regulations into regulatory deliverables.
  • Contributing to controlled and accurate finance data through data quality checks.
  • Fuelling operational efficiency through automation.
What you’ll be doing:
  • Build and maintain accurate, efficient reporting datasets to meet regulatory requirements critical to obtaining and retaining operating licenses across multiple legal entities, and to fulfil our audit and external partnership obligations.
  • Automate reporting workflows to minimise manual intervention and enable self-service for end users.
  • Design and build intuitive data visualisations that present periodic summaries, control results, trends, and variances to stakeholders in a clear and accessible way.
  • Develop robust data quality controls and integrate them into automated reporting workflows alongside monitoring and alerting mechanisms.
  • Liaise with regulatory, prudential, and financial controllers, as well as regional product, compliance, and banking teams, to develop a thorough understanding of regulations and accurately map them to internal data points.
  • Collaborate with analytics engineering and analysts across functions to keep pace with evolving data infrastructure and integrate cross-functional attributes into regulatory datasets.
  • Investigate and drive resolution of complex data discrepancies, stakeholder queries, and internal control findings.
  • Champion and uphold reporting standards and best practices across the team.
  • Leverage Wise's tech stack, including modern AI and agentic tools, and stay current with emerging capabilities to improve reporting workflows and team efficiency.
Technical skills:
  • Advanced SQL: Ability to independently build efficient, readable queries spanning data extraction, transformation, and DDL/DML operations.
  • Hands-on DBT experience, including materialisation strategy trade-offs and data quality testing.
  • Experience working with a modern data warehouse such as Snowflake.
  • Comfortable working with high-volume data.
  • Python proficiency strongly preferred.
  • Skilled with an orchestration tool such as Airflow.
  • Proficient with version control, ideally Git and GitHub.
  • Competent with a data visualisation tool such as Looker, Lightdash, or Superset.
  • Demonstrable understanding of fundamental accounting principles and financial statements.
  • Proficient in Excel and similar spreadsheet tools.
  • Understanding of cloud services, preferably AWS.
  • Demonstrated use of AI and agentic tools in a professional setting.
